Abstract

The invention provides liquid electrographic toner compositions comprising a liquid carrier having toner particles and at least one soluble polymer dispersed in the liquid carrier. The liquid carrier has a Kauri-Butanol number less than about 30 mL. The toner particles comprise polymeric binder comprising at least one amphipathic copolymer comprising one or more S material portions and one or more D material portions. The soluble polymer is present in an amount of from about 1% to about 10% by weight based on toner particle weight. The absolute difference in Hildebrand solubility parameters between the soluble polymer and the liquid carrier is less than about 3.0 MPa. In one aspect of the invention, the soluble polymer that is incorporated in the toner composition has no more than about 30% weight ratio chemical constitution variance from the chemical constitution of the S material portion of the amphipathic copolymer.
